Poultry breeders want to start a price guarantee fund
Tibor Zászlós, vice president of the Hungarian Chamber of Agriculture (NAK) has told that the poultry sector can only become more competitive if technological development projects are realised. State funding is important for the sector, and the damages caused by market processes to farmers need to be offset by establishing an income stabilisation fund. //
